17.11.2018fromAdrian Montagu
I found thes tyres to be excellent when dealing with standing water as they have deep and wide grooves. But big grooves mean less rubber on the road and that means that they wear out quicker. The rubber is softer than the Dunlops I had before. For cornering and braking in the wet they are excellent. A fairly quiet tyre. My driving style is mixed and I sometimes drift swiftly on winding twisting roads. On the motorways I cruise along at 70mph / 110kmph. I don&#39;t brake harshly but when I have to, the tyres are really good.

31.03.2021fromAlan Foster
I bought these tyres because I do occasional track days. If I drive hard on a track day the outer edge of my front tyres are heavily worn. I wanted a tyre that would withstand a track day, but still be good for everyday use. This tryre is perfect for this. Not outer edge issues at all on track day and plenty of grip in wet winter on normal roads. My fuel consumption has increased a lot. I do not know if this is the tyres (only fitted on front) or because I am doing shorter trips due to lock down.
16.08.2018fromOllie
For a summer tyre, these are great in the wet, adimitadly there&#39;s still plenty of tread left so this could be part of this. A lot of people said these were no good in the wet, that&#39;s rubbish. Damp or wet roads these still have better levels of grip than a normal road tyre, they just don&#39;t handle standing water very well (As would be expected this this type of tyre). As long as you drive to the conditions you won&#39;t have any issues with rain. I&#39;ve even had 3 days in the snow with these...lets just make it clear these are NOT snow tyres but they done suprisingly well. The only thing I noticed is that you have to warm them up, when cold they seem a bit loose. After a few minutes driving they get to decent levels of grip but you need to drive a bit harder than normal road conditions to get them to full potential. It would have been nice if they were still available in this size with the softer compound. They are on the latest MSA list 1B though so don&#39;t get caught out - some of the smaller events like the autosolos won&#39;t allow you to run with them. The side walls are stiff enough to give some sharp turn in but you trade that off with road noise and a stiffer ride but again that is to be expected. All in all these are great tyres for the price.
